Record and development:
Internet poker appeared within the late 1990s because of developments in technology and also the net. The first online poker room, globe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a small but enthusiastic neighborhood. However, it was at early 2000s that internet poker practiced exponential development, mainly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Recognition and Accessibility:
One of the most significant cause of the enormous popularity of internet poker is its accessibility. Players can get on a common on-line poker platforms whenever you want, from anywhere, utilizing their computers or mobile devices. This convenience has actually drawn a diverse player base, which range from leisure people to specialists, causing the fast growth of on-line poker.

Features of Internet Poker:
Internet poker provides a few benefits over traditional br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it offers a larger range of game choices, including numerous poker variants and stakes, providing towards the preferences and budgets of all of the forms of players. Furthermore, on-line poker areas tend to be open 24/7, eliminating the limitations of actual casino running hours. In addition, internet based platforms often offer appealing incentives, respect programs, together with capability to play numerous tables simultaneously, boosting the overall gaming experience.
